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K filing by Cheniere Energy, Inc. reports a material definitive agreement entered into on November 25, 2013. The transaction involves Sabine Pass Liquefaction, LLC ("SPL"), a wholly owned subsidiary of Cheniere Energy Partners, L.P., which is an indirect majority-owned subsidiary of Cheniere Energy, Inc.
Key Financial Metrics
The filing details a debt financing transaction rather than operational financial results. Key metrics include:
- Debt Issuance: $1.0 billion aggregate principal amount of 6.25% Senior Secured Notes due 2022.
- Interest Rate: 6.25% per annum, payable semi-annually in cash in arrears.
- Maturity Date: March 15, 2022.
- Security Status: Senior secured obligations of SPL, ranking equal to existing senior secured indebtedness and effectively senior to unsecured senior indebtedness to the extent of collateral value.
- Guarantees: Not guaranteed as of the issue date; future restricted subsidiaries will provide joint and several guarantees.
Material Changes
The primary material change is the creation of a new direct financial obligation of $1.0 billion. This increases the company's leverage and fixed interest obligations. The Notes were sold on a private placement basis pursuant to Section 4(2) of the Securities Act and Rule 144A and Regulation S, meaning they were not registered under the Securities Act of 1933 at the time of issuance.
Outlook, Risks, and Covenants
Redemption Terms: SPL may redeem the Notes prior to December 15, 2021, at a "make-whole" price. On or after December 15, 2021, the Notes may be redeemed at 100% of the principal amount plus accrued interest.
Covenants: The Indenture imposes customary covenants limiting SPL's ability to incur additional indebtedness, issue preferred stock, make certain investments, pay dividends, sell assets, or enter into certain LNG sales contracts. These covenants are subject to limitations and exceptions.
Registration Rights: SPL entered into a Registration Rights Agreement to use commercially reasonable efforts to file a registration statement for an exchange offer within 360 days of the issue date. Failure to comply may result in additional interest payments.
Risks: The filing does not provide specific quantitative risk factors beyond the standard debt service obligations and covenant restrictions inherent in the Indenture.
